How to Get a German Driving License Fast

Getting a driving license in Germany can frequently feel like a lengthy and convoluted process. However, with the right approach and preparation, it is possible to expedite your journey. This guide intends to provide you with a thorough introduction of how to get a German driving license quickly, including practical steps, suggestions, and responses to frequently asked questions.

0YWKA6-LogoMakr.png

Comprehending the German Driving License System

Initially, it's crucial to understand how the German driving license system works. There are numerous kinds of licenses depending upon the classification of car. The most typical is the Class B license for automobiles, which is required to drive lorries approximately 3.5 loads and holding no more than eight travelers (omitting the motorist).

Kinds Of German Driving Licenses

License ClassVehicle TypeMinimum AgeKey Restrictions
Class AMotorcycles (over 125cc)24Varies by experience (2 years)
Class A1Motorbikes (as much as 125cc)16Restricted engine capacity
Class BAutomobiles (up to 3.5 loads)18No greater than 8 passengers
Class CTrucks (over 3.5 heaps)21Needs extra training
Class DBuses24Needs additional training

Steps to Obtain Your German Driving License Quickly

1. Enroll in a Driving School (Fahrschule)

The initial step is to select a reliable driving school. In Germany, driving schools use plans that consist of both theoretical and useful lessons. Choosing a school that is understood for effectiveness can significantly reduce the time it takes to get your license.

Key Considerations:

  • Reputation: Look for evaluations and reviews.
  • Area: Choose a school near to your home or work environment.
  • Language: Ensure that the lessons are provided in a language you comprehend well.

2. Total the Theoretical Course

The theoretical part includes classes covering road signs, guidelines, and policies. To expedite this procedure:

  • Attend Regular Classes: Regular attendance will keep you engaged and accelerate your studies.
  • Usage Supplementary Materials: Leverage apps and online resources for self-study.

3. Pass the Theoretical Exam

When you've finished the theoretical course, you'll be required to take a composed exam. To prepare efficiently for this:

  • Mock Tests: Practice with mock tests to familiarize yourself with the exam format.
  • Research study Groups: Join a study hall to exchange understanding and suggestions.

4. Complete Practical Lessons

The practical driving lessons are where you put your understanding into action. Here are some pointers to maximize your useful sessions:

  • Practice Regularly: Schedule lessons consistently.
  • Replicate Test Conditions: Drive in numerous conditions (highways, city driving) to gain detailed experience.
  • Concentrate On Weak Areas: Work on particular abilities that you find challenging.

5. Pass the Practical Exam

After completing the needed number of lessons, you'll be prepared to take the useful driving test. To prepare:

  • Know the Test Routes: Familiarize yourself with typical test paths used in your area.
  • Stay Calm: Practice relaxation strategies to reduce anxiety on exam day.

Fast-Tracking Your Application

If you're seeking to speed up the whole application procedure, think about these additional pointers:

  • Total the First Aid Course: This is a requirement for getting your license, so get it done as early as possible.
  • Schedule Your Exams Promptly: Don't delay in scheduling both theoretical and practical exams.

Required Documents

DocumentDescription
IdentificationPassport or nationwide ID card
Biometric PhotosCurrent passport-style images
Proof of ResidenceRegistration certificate (Anmeldung)
First Aid CertificateCompletion of a standard very first aid course
Eye Test CertificateVerification from an optician
